How do hospitals plan for workforce shortages?

Healthcare institutions face a rising dilemma as they try to handle an increasing shortage of their workforce. Standard operations to address staff deficiencies in hospitals include the following sequence:


1. Strategic Workforce Planning:  

By analyzing existing employee patterns hospitals create forecasts about upcoming staffing deficits through assessment of patient load projections alongside employee retiring patterns and health service needs.

2. Cross-Training Staff:  

Staff retention stays decisive because hospitals train their workers to handle different responsibilities when existing staff arrays reduce.

3. Hiring Temporary and Travel Staff:  

When specific periods become critical hospitals implement the utilization of both temporary nurses and physicians as well as allied health professionals.

4. Investing in Technology:  

The implementation of EHR systems (Electronic Health Records) along with AI-based scheduling software eliminates repetitive work and streamlines operational processes.

5. Enhancing Retention Programs:  

Experienced medical staff remains with the organization when they receive improved employment benefits together with flexible schedule options and mzined career development potential.

6. Collaborating with Educational Institutions:  

Medical institutions form alliances with nursing and medical training centers to establish continuous recruitment of new healthcare staff.

7. Utilizing Data and Analytics:  

The analysis of data allows organizations to both recognize workforce deficit areas allowing them to create specific strategies to improve recruitment and workplace training.

8. Emergency Staffing Plans:  

Emergency contingency plans of hospitals consist of fast-track hiring processes and volunteer lists to respond to emergencies.
